HILLSBOROUGH: Doris Duke portrait to be unveiled

Annual art exhibit will be held in municipal building

   Township resident Kathleen Fritz’s portrait of Doris Duke will be unveiled at the opening night of the Hillsborough Cultural Arts Commission-sponsored annual art exhibit and competition on Friday evening.
   Kathleen, 16, has been an apprentice at the Art Academy of Hillsborough with Kevin Murphy, a member of the Cultural Arts Commission and owner of the art academy, since last June and will have her portrait Ms. Duke entered into the Hillsborough Township Public Art Collection.
   Ms. Duke, who died in 1993, was an heiress, horticulturist and philanthropist and only child of the Duke family associated with tobacco and energy companies. Much of the family estate in the township remains as a 2,700-acre preserve.
   The art exhibit will be held from April 1-4 at the Municipal Complex and feature Somerset County High School students and Hillsborough adults. It will showcase more than 250 pieces of work in four categories, high school art, high school photography, adult art and adult photography, and be judged by six professional artists and photographers, who will also display some of their work.
   The opening reception, awards and unveiling will take place on Friday from 7 to 9 p.m. A total of $2,400 in prizes will be awarded in addition to prize ribbons and certificates.
   The students participating in the show hail from high schools, including Bridgewater-Raritan, Franklin, Hillsborough, Montgomery, Ridge, Somerville and the Home School Association, of which Kathleen is a member. Each participant will select pieces to represent their school from top art and photography students. The lion’s share of the work selected will come from students pursuing a career in the field and adults who are professional or have a knack for art.
